Jobs Career Advice Signup

Send this job to a friend


Did you notice an error or suspect this job is scam? Tell us.

  • Posted: Sep 2, 2021
    Deadline: Not specified
  • Old Mutual Limited (OML) is a premium African financial services group that offers a broad spectrum of financial solutions to retail and corporate customers across key markets in 14 countries.

    Read more about this company


    Senior Analyst Programmer

    Job Description

    This is a Senior Development role including design of specifications, coding, implementation, testing, data conversion and documentation and system enhancements. The incumbent is individually accountable for achieving results through own efforts.

    • A Senior programming function that constructs solutions, including design of specifications, programming, implementation and testing (unit, systems & integration testing).
    • Designs the test strategy and / or test plans.
    • Conducts data conversion and documents new systems and systems enhancements.
    • Provides higher-level technical and programming support to Programmers / Analyst Programmers and Junior Programmers.
    • Analyses and assists with design of new systems and databases.
    • Assists Business Analyst and Architect to translate strategic decisions into Business Solutions.
    • Required to advise Management on effective applications, covering areas such as maintenance, support, man-machine interface and data management requirements.
    • Provides sizing and scoping for development work required
    • Operates as a subject matter expert across program initiatives
    • Expected to task lead on certain work initiatives
    • Coaches and mentors new staff (programmers and analyst programmers).
    • Provides Lead Technical direction
    • Leads large scale applications eg. Flexcube , Inspire, Wealth Integrator and Bizagi
    • Builds prototypes to assist the business with user requirements

    Drives out business requirements

    • Provide production support through warrantee period
    • May need to train the business on new applications (in the absence of a BA)
    • No supervision required

    Extract, validate and analyse data to answer strategic and operational questions.

    • Automate data extraction and report update processes.
    • Design, build and support the components of data warehouse, such as ETL processes, databases, reports, and reporting environments.
    • Develop and automate ETL processes that involve error and reconciliation handling.
    • Knowledge on web frameworks and technologies such as:
    • AngularJS, Angular, Node,  jQuery, Twitter Bootstrap, HTML, ASP.Net, CSS, ASP.MVC (Razor), WCF, Web API, Entity Framework, Oracle,  SQL Server, Visual Studio etc.
    • Cloud-based technologies would be advantageous



    • ASP.NET MVC, C# .NET Programming, Cascading Style Sheets (CSS), Excellent communication skills, Hyper Text Markup Language (HTML), jQuery, Problem Solving, Systems Analysis Design, Technical Design Documentation, Twitter Bootstrap, Web APIs


    • Bachelor of Science (BSc): Information Technology (Required), Diploma (Dip): Information Technology (Required), Matriculation Certificate (Matric) (Required)


    Method of Application

    Interested and qualified? Go to Old Mutual on to apply

    Note: Never pay for any training, certificate, assessment, or testing to the recruiter.

  • Send your application

    View All Vacancies at Old Mutual Back To Home

Career Advice

View All Career Advice

Subscribe to Job Alert


Join our happy subscribers

Send your application through

GmailGmail YahoomailYahoomail